What This Code Means
R82.998 is the ICD-10-CM diagnosis code for other abnormal findings in urine. Other abnormal chemical or metabolic findings in urine that are not classified elsewhere. R82.998 sits in the ICD-10-CM chapter for symptoms, signs and abnormal clinical and laboratory findings, not elsewhere classified (r00-r99), within the section covering abnormal findings on examination of urine, without diagnosis (r80-r82).
R82.998 is a billable ICD-10-CM code but does not map to a payment HCC under the CMS-HCC V28, V24, ESRD, or RxHCC risk adjustment models. It can be reported on Medicare Advantage encounter data submissions but it does not contribute to a beneficiary's RAF score and therefore does not affect risk-adjusted payments to the plan.
Use when specific metabolic abnormalities are documented but don't match other R82.99x codes.

Coding Tips
- •Use when specific metabolic abnormalities are documented but don't match other R82.99x codes
- •Include documentation of the specific abnormality found for clarity
